Use case profile
Best for
Scuba divingUnderwater photographyFishingCave explorationWater work
EDC with multiple lighting modesNight searchesRepairsEmergency lightingMaintenance inspections using UV light
Common praise
Very bright 5000 lumens with long 244 meter beam distanceOutstanding color rendering with CRI 90 warm light and neutral white optionDurable aluminum construction with IPX8 100m waterproof ratingConvenient USB-C recharge and included high-capacity batterySimple yet effective dual-switch interface with battery level indication
Multiple lighting modes including spot, flood, red, and UVHigh maximum brightness and long throwAdjustable color temperature on floodlightConvenient foldable and rotatable floodlight wingDurable aluminum alloy constructionIncluded rechargeable 21700 battery with USB-C chargingMagnetic base and mounting options for hands-free use
Common complaints
Relatively heavy at 331 grams with batteryLarge size compared to typical EDC flashlightsNo detailed official specs for the included proprietary battery
Red and UV light quality not perfect (Red beam not smooth close-up; UV has visible light spill)Magnetic rotary selector switch can be rough and slowStrobe modes produce loud clicking noiseWater resistance limited by foldable wing designWing mechanism may cause scratches on body over timeHeavier than typical EDC flashlights
